John Wayne to Long Beach
fellas, what is the best public transportation from John Wayne airport to Long Beach airport without burning a hole in your wallet? TIA

Take cab/bus/walk to Tustin Metrolink station (about 3 miles away).
Take Metrolink Orange County Line to Union Station Transfer to Red Line Subway at Union Station Transfer to Blue Line at 7th Street/Metro Center station Take Blue Line to Long Beach Hahaha That would probably take you 3 hours Dude, you're going to have to rent a car or take a cab, or take a bus. It's about 20 miles. Or you could try to fly into Long Beach. |
